|
AutoLisp : einfügepunkt ändern
michelangelo am 11.05.2004 um 19:29 Uhr (0)
habe folgendes Lisp, bei cadWiesel gedownloadet. das ist super. aber wie kann ich den einfügepunkt ändern.? oder wen ich noch ein text in die mitte des rechtecks setzenmöchte. wie heisst diese variable? und wo kann ich solche sachen nachlesen??? ; Lisp-Programm zum Erzeugen eines Rechtecks Einfüge-Punkt Mitte ; 25.6.97 Lieske (defun c:rack ( / ech osn key_laenge key_hoehe pp p1 p2 p3 p4) ;GLOBAL: ZAHL: laenge hoehe ; STRING: ed_laenge ed_hoehe (setq ech (getvar CMDECHO )) (setvar ...
|
| In das Form AutoLisp wechseln |
|
CoCreate Programmierung : Fortlaufender Variablenname
clausb am 23.04.2009 um 19:32 Uhr (0)
Gegen die Verwendung von Strukturen (die mit defstruct definiert werden) ist gar nichts einzuwenden - meine Zweifel betrafen die Idee, dynamisch Variablen zu erzeugen. Wie gesagt, Lisp kann sowas im Unterschied zu vielen anderen Sprachen, aber selbst in Lisp nutzt man solche Moeglichkeiten nicht so oft, meistens eher in mit defmacro erzeugten Makros.Dein Problem bei der Erweiterung des Arrays ist ein simples Quotierungsproblem, das wir schon ab und an mal hatten. Abhilfe:Code:(setf ergebnis_array (adj ...
|
| In das Form CoCreate Programmierung wechseln |
|
Rund um Autocad : Eigene Menüdatei einbinden
Theodor Schoenwald am 03.03.2003 um 18:34 Uhr (0)
Hallo Karsten, das folgende Lisp-Tool benutze ich um das Menü "CNC" einzufügen. Du kannst es für dich umstricken. Gruß Theodor ;;Datei zur Installation der Menügruppe CNC ;; (defun C:ML (/ POS) (setq POS (getint "
.
.
An welcher Stelle soll das CNC-Menü eingefügt werden? 11 : ")) (if (= POS NIL) (setq POS 11) ) (setq POS (rtos POS 2 0)) (setvar "FILEDIA" 0) (command "_MENULOAD" "CNC") (MENUCMD (strcat "P" POS "=+CNC.POP1")) (setvar "FILEDIA" 1) (princ) ) (prompt"
. Bitte mit "ML" starten") ...
|
| In das Form Rund um Autocad wechseln |
|
Rund um Autocad : Text automatisch mehrfach übernehmen?
marc.scherer am 09.04.2003 um 09:59 Uhr (0)
Hi, Das was Du willst ist via Lisp oder VBA oder C kein Problem. Mußt nur einen finden der es Dir baut, ist halt SEHR speziell. Da wirst Du nix fertiges finden. Wenn Du es nicht selber programmieren willst: Guck doch mal auf diese Website... www.cadlon.de Da könntest Du für kleines Geld so ein Pgm. in Auftrag geben. ------------------ Ciao, Marc [Diese Nachricht wurde von marc.scherer am 09. April 2003 editiert.]
|
| In das Form Rund um Autocad wechseln |
|
Makro Programmierung : Werte von sd-am-inq-info-attributes abfragen
Michael Kahle am 24.10.2005 um 11:17 Uhr (0)
Also die Strings muss man nicht unbedingt zerpfluecken (kommt natuerlich drauf an was man anstellen moechte). Zunaechst muss man aber mal die Liste durchnudeln. Entweder mit (dolist (ein-string attr-liste) (mach-was-mit ein-string)) oder gleich gezielt testen oder raussuchen mit find bzw. member.Siehe Lisp-Reference.------------------Viele Gruesse, Michael--Spam goes SPAM@CoCreate.com and spam@postini.com ;-)
|
| In das Form Makro Programmierung wechseln |
|
ADT Architectural Desktop : Suche Tools Böschungsschraffur Höhenlinienbeschriftung
charlieBV am 30.03.2005 um 18:45 Uhr (0)
Hi und Herzlich Willkommen, ich nutze das Lisp: http://ww3.cad.de/foren/ubb/Forum54/HTML/001229.shtml#000004 wie man es läd seht ihr hier: http://ww3.cad.de/foren/ubb/Forum54/HTML/007058.shtml Das mit den Höhenlinien weiß ich nicht, aber ihr kännt auch hier mal Suchen: http://ww3.cad.de/cgi-bin/ubb/forumdisplay.cgi?action=topics&forum=Rund+um+Autocad&number=54&DaysPrune=1000&LastLogin=&mystyle=AUGCE ------------------ Gruß Yvonne
|
| In das Form ADT Architectural Desktop wechseln |
|
Rund um Autocad : Mehr als 5 Benutzerspez. Papiergrößen
Brischke am 27.05.2004 um 09:25 Uhr (0)
Hallo Astrid, da hast du einmal zuviel geklickt. Du darfst keinen bestimmten Drucker öffnen, sondern in dem Dialogfenster, in dem alle drucker gelistet sind, im Menü Datei die Servereigenschaften öffnen. Diese gelten für alle Drucker. Grüße Holger ------------------ Holger Brischke (defun - Lisp over night! AutoLISP-Programmierung für AutoCAD Da weiß man, wann man s hat! Treffen Sie (defun auf dem Autodesk Anwendertreffen am 15.06. in Steyr/Österreich !
|
| In das Form Rund um Autocad wechseln |
|
Rund um Autocad : Suche Möglichkeiten ( z.B. Lisp )...
AndreasKaz am 18.01.2002 um 13:55 Uhr (0)
Hi, dafür haben wir ein super Tool. Hole von www.dxf.de DeepControl. Dort kannst Du die "doppelten Elemente" löschen oder auf einen Layer legen. Toleranz kann auch angegeben werden. DeepControl ist ein selbständiges Programm. Wenn Du lieber unter AutoCAD arbeiten willst, dann hole DWGKONV. DWGKONV ist ein AutoCAD-Zusatzprogramm. Es hat die gleichen Möglichkeiten bezüglich "doppelte elemente" wie DeepControl. Grüße Andreas
|
| In das Form Rund um Autocad wechseln |
|
AutoCAD Civil 3D : Korbbogen
Moehm am 26.02.2026 um 14:11 Uhr (5)
Huhu... ich hab das Civil 2025 und 2026 installiert und finde im Leben nicht wie ich einen 3-teiligen Korbbogen konstruieren kann. Das ging doch mal... Kann mir da bitte jemand helfen? Und bitte keinen dynamischen Block (das funzt bei mir nicht richtig) oder ne Lisp. Hab ja noch ein anderes Tiefbauprogramm, damit helf ich mir grade weiter, aber ist ja nicht der Weg. Gruß, Melli[Diese Nachricht wurde von Moehm am 26. Feb. 2026 editiert.]
|
| In das Form AutoCAD Civil 3D wechseln |
|
AutoLisp : AutoCAD PROTECTED LISP file
Theodor Schoenwald am 07.01.2004 um 19:26 Uhr (0)
Hallo Ciao, das Programm CONVERT kann so etwas, aber wenn der Autor sein Programm vor dem Schützen mit dem Kelvinator noch verkrumpelt hat, nützt Dir die ganze Arbeit nicht viel. Um dann im Lispprogramm herumzuwusteln, musst Du sehr gut sein und wenn Du gut bist, hast Du die ganze Sache nicht nötig. Das Forum hilft Dir, wenn Du selbst was basteln willst. Gruß Theodor
|
| In das Form AutoLisp wechseln |
|
Autocad LT : Befehl wiederholen
CAD-Huebner am 24.03.2005 um 20:14 Uhr (0)
Ansonsten geht auch der Befehl NOCHMAL , sowhol auf der Befehlszeile als auch aus dem Menü. Auf der Befehlszeile so: NOCHMAL FLÄCHE Mit der Options gehts allerdings nur mit einem kleinen Lisp Makro: Code: (defun C:flächeObj() (command _area _o )) Danach einfach NOCHMAL FLÄCHEOBJ und dann Endlosflächenberechnung von Objekten. ------------------ Mit freundlichem Gruß Udo Hübner ---------- Der versteckte Fehler bleibt nie unentdeckt. [Diese Nachricht wurde von CAD-Huebner am 24. Mrz. 2005 ed ...
|
| In das Form Autocad LT wechseln |
|
AutoLisp : Layer in bestehenden Layouts frieren!?
Erwin Fortelny am 26.09.2003 um 10:31 Uhr (0)
Hallo! Zitat: Original erstellt von Kramer24: ich kann jemanden im Lisp-Forum helfen... Hatte ich gerade vor 4 Tagen: Ja, sieht ganz gut aus! Zitat: Original erstellt von Kramer24: Den Hinweis auf die Suchfunktion erspare ich Dir Danke! Ist sonst eigenlich nicht meine Art einfach draufloszuposten, aber der Beitrag ist mir durch die Lappen gegangen ... Asche auf mein Haupt! ------------------ Servus, Erwin -- erwin.fortelny@gmx.at
|
| In das Form AutoLisp wechseln |
|
AutoLisp : Textstil im Bemaßungsstil ???
fbeckersm am 13.05.2004 um 14:38 Uhr (0)
Hallo @all! Ich habe ein Problem! Ich baue mir meine eigene Lispdatei, leider bin ich blutiger Anfänger, und komme einfach nicht weiter. Ich will automatisch Textstile bereinigen. Klappt auch alles gut, bis auf ein Textstil, der leider als Text in einem Bemaßungsstil eingestellt ist. Zu dem kommt noch, dass es eine Stilüberschreibung gibt, die gelöscht werden kann... wie ist der code für meine LISP?? Mit der Variablen DIMTXSTY komm ich nicht weiter... leider... mfg Flo
|
| In das Form AutoLisp wechseln |